Understanding Ovens

Ovens are important for cooking and baking and can be found in different types to satisfy diverse culinary requirements. Here is a summary of the most common kinds of ovens:

1. Standard Ovens

Traditional ovens work by heating the air inside with gas or electric elements. They are ideal for baking cakes, roasting meats, and cooking casseroles.

2. Convection Ovens

These ovens utilize a fan to flow hot air, offering an even temperature level throughout, which can considerably decrease cooking times. They are perfect for baking cookies or roasting veggies.

3. Microwave Ovens

Microwaves cook food quickly utilizing electro-magnetic radiation. They are best hob for reheating leftovers or thawing frozen foods however are not suitable for browning or crisping.

4. Wall Ovens

Including a wall oven into your kitchen style can conserve space and develop a smooth visual. They function much like standard or stoves but are built into the wall for simple gain access to.

5. Range Ovens

These ovens combine stovetop burners with an oven, offering flexibility for those who choose a single appliance for all cooking needs.

Exploring Hobs

Hobs, also known as cooktops or stovetops, supply the surface area to prepare pans straight over a heat source. Like ovens, hobs can be found in different types, which can be categorized as follows:

1. Gas Hobs

These hobs use a flame for cooking and offer immediate heat control. They are favored by many chefs for their responsiveness and accuracy.

2. Electric Hobs

Electric hobs use coils or flat surface areas to heat pans. They offer a constant heat source, but they might take longer to cool down compared to gas hobs.

3. Induction Hobs

Induction hobs use electromagnetic energy to heat pots and pans directly, making them extremely efficient and faster to prepare. They are likewise much easier to clean up as the surface area remains relatively cool.

4. Solid Plate Hobs

These are older technology that uses solid metal plates to provide heat. They are durable however are less effective than modern-day alternatives.

Choosing the Right Appliances

Picking the best oven and hob uk for your kitchen includes considering different elements:

1. Space and Layout

Procedure your kitchen location to identify the size and positioning of the oven and hob. Make sure there is appropriate ventilation, specifically for gas home appliances.

2. Cooking Style

Think about how often you cook and the type of meals you prepare. A convection oven might fit passionate bakers, while somebody who often stir-fries may prefer an induction hob.

3. Energy Source

Choose the energy source that best fits your way of life. Gas provides instant control, while electric and induction hobs oven offer ease of use and are often more energy-efficient.

4. Budget

Determine your budget plan for kitchen devices. Ovens and hobs vary substantially in price, depending on functions and brands. Focus on necessary features that satisfy your needs.

5. Features

Search for functionalities such as self-cleaning options, smart technology compatibility, particular rack setups for ovens, and security functions for hobs.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: What is the difference in between a standard oven hob and a convection oven?A1: Conventional ovens heat up the air within without fans, while convection ovens make use of a fan to distribute hot air for more even cooking. Q2: Can I utilize aluminum pots and pans on induction hobs?A2: No, oven and hob induction hobs need ferrous (magnetic )materials like cast iron or stainless steel to work successfully. Q3: Do gas hobs heat faster than electric hobs?A3: Yes, gas hobs offer immediate heat, making them much faster for cooking compared to electric hobs. Q4: Is it safe to use a microwave oven?A4: Yes, when used according to the maker's guidelines, microwave ovens are thought about safe for cooking.
